1
羞辱
to cause someone to feel extremely embarrassed or ashamed, often by publicly exposing their weaknesses or shortcomings
及物动词
- The bully's cruel words were meant to humiliate his victim in front of their peers.
霸凌者残酷的话语意在在同伴面前羞辱他的受害者。
- It's never acceptable to humiliate someone for their differences or vulnerabilities.
因为某人的差异或弱点而羞辱他们,这是永远不可接受的。
- The public rejection humiliated him and shattered his confidence.
公开的拒绝羞辱了他,并粉碎了他的信心。
- She vowed to never again put herself in a situation where she could be humiliated.
她发誓再也不让自己陷入可能被羞辱的境地。
